Line the bottom of your 9-inch cake pan with parchment and lightly grease the sides. This ensures easy release and perfect shape.
Place the egg whites in a medium bowl and the yolks in a larger bowl. Beat the whites until soft peaks form and set aside. This gives the cake its fluffy texture.
In the large bowl with yolks, whisk in the honey, Greek yogurt, oil, vanilla extract, and lemon zest. Stir until smooth and creamy.
In a separate bowl, mix fl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Slowly add this to the wet mixture, stirring until just combined. Don’t overmix — it keeps the cake tender.
Gently fold in one-third of the egg whites to lighten the batter, then fold in the rest. Be careful not to deflate the mixture.
Toss the blueberries in 1 tablespoon of flour to prevent them from sinking to the bottom. Then fold them into the batter gently.
Pour the batter into the prepared pan, spreading it evenly. Bake for 35–40 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
Allow the cake to cool in the pan for 10 minutes before transferring it to a wire rack. Slice and enjoy warm or chilled.
